CHERRY COBBLER

By

A favorite served with vanilla bean ice cream.

Ingredients

  • For filling
  • 6 cups fresh or frozen dark red cherries 1 1/4 cups sugar Unsweetened, pitted 1/4 cup water
  • 4 tsp cornstarch
  • For topping
  • 1 cup all purpose flour 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1/2 tsp baking powder 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on 3 tbs margarine or butter 1 beaten egg
  • 3 tbs milk

Details

Preparation

Step 1

Mix cherries with 1 1/4 cups sugar, 1/4 cup water and 4 tsp cornstarch. 15 minutes. Cook and stir until thickened and bubbly. Keep warm. Let stand Mix flour, 1/4 cup sugar, baking powder and cinnamon. Cut in margarine until mixture resembles course crumbs. In separate whisk together egg and milk. Add top flour mixture, stirring just to moisten.
Transfer filling to 8X8X2 baking dish. Drop topping into 6 mounds atop hot filling. Bake at 4000 for 20-25 minutes or until toothpick insert in topping comes out clean. Serve warm with ice cream.
